Social Responsibility
Social responsibility is an ethical ideology or theory that an entity, be it an organization or individual, has an obligation to act to benefit society at large.

Creating Activists Through Journalism!Activism consists of efforts to promote, impede, or direct social, political, economic, or environmental change. Activism can take a wide range of forms from writing letters to newspapers or politicians, political campaigning, economic activism such as boycotts or preferentially patronizing businesses, rallies, street marches, strikes, sit-ins, and hunger strikes. This is what Lewis Hines acheived when he helped eliminate child labor.

Issue ReportingIssue or crisis reporting most often means photojournalists are covering local or global issues that affect human rights or the environment.

Issues With EthicsWhen journalists are covering human rights issues, ethics can often come into play.
What are ethics?1. A system of moral principles: the ethics of a culture.
2. The rules of conduct recognized in respect to a particular class of human actions or a particular group, culture, etc.: medical ethics; Christian ethics.
3. Moral principles, as of an individual: His ethics forbade betrayal of a confidence.
